Abstract
A tampon is proposed, with an insertion end and a rear end, made from a pressed absorbent strip () and a withdrawal string () running out of the rear end. In order to achieve short production times during manufacture of the tampon, the withdrawal string () is placed around the strip () in the shape of a loop, and the strip () is provided with a fold () at each side of the loop ().
